# soulmachine/machine-learning-cheat-sheet

Classical equations and diagrams in machine learning
TeX
Latest commit 0463163 Apr 14, 2016 Merge pull request #9 from jackeylu/master
Update chapterOptimization.tex
 Failed to load latest commit information. figures May 26, 2014 styles Dec 15, 2013 .gitignore May 26, 2014 README.md Feb 12, 2015 acknow.tex May 15, 2013 acronym.tex May 15, 2013 cblist.tex Nov 18, 2013 chapterABM.tex Dec 15, 2013 chapterBayesianStatistics.tex Dec 16, 2013 chapterClustering.tex Dec 10, 2013 chapterDGM.tex Dec 12, 2013 chapterDeepLearning.tex Dec 10, 2013 chapterEM.tex Dec 16, 2013 chapterExactInferenceForGraphicalModels.tex Dec 10, 2013 chapterFrequentistStatistics.tex Dec 11, 2013 chapterGLM.tex Dec 16, 2013 chapterGP.tex Dec 12, 2013 chapterGenerativeModels.tex May 26, 2014 chapterGraphicalModelStructureLearning.tex Dec 10, 2013 chapterHMM.tex May 26, 2014 chapterIntroduction.tex Oct 31, 2014 chapterKernels.tex Dec 16, 2013 chapterLVM.tex May 26, 2014 chapterLatentLinearModels.tex Dec 16, 2013 chapterLinearRegression.tex Feb 12, 2015 chapterLogisticRegression.tex Dec 16, 2013 chapterMCMC.tex May 26, 2014 chapterMVN.tex Dec 16, 2013 chapterMonteCarloInference.tex May 26, 2014 chapterMoreVariationalInference.tex Dec 10, 2013 chapterOptimization.tex May 19, 2015 chapterProbability.tex Apr 20, 2015 chapterSSM.tex Dec 10, 2013 chapterSparseLinearModels.tex Dec 9, 2013 chapterStructureLearning.tex Dec 10, 2013 chapterUGM.tex Dec 10, 2013 chapterVariationalInference.tex Dec 10, 2013 dedic.tex May 15, 2013 foreword.tex May 15, 2013 glossary.tex May 15, 2013 machine-learning-cheat-sheet.pdf Feb 12, 2015 machine-learning-cheat-sheet.tex Dec 15, 2013 notation.tex Feb 12, 2015 part.tex May 15, 2013 preface.tex Sep 15, 2014 referenc.tex May 15, 2013 titlepage.tex Dec 11, 2013

# Machine learning cheat sheet

This cheat sheet contains many classical equations and diagrams on machine learning, which will help you quickly recall knowledge and ideas on machine learning.

The cheat sheet will also appeal to someone who is preparing for a job interview related to machine learning.

## LaTeX template

This open-source book adopts the Springer latex template.

## How to compile on Windows

1. Install Tex Live 2014, then add its bin path for example D:\texlive\2012\bin\win32 to he PATH environment variable.
2. Install TeXstudio.
3. Configure TeXstudio.
Run TeXstudio, click Options-->Configure Texstudio-->Commands, set XeLaTex to xelatex -synctex=1 -interaction=nonstopmode %.tex.

Click Options-->Configure Texstudio-->Build,
set Build & View to Compile & View,
set Default Compiler to XeLaTex,
set PDF Viewer to Internal PDF Viewer(windowed), so that when previewing it will pop up a standalone window, which will be convenient.

4. Compile. Use Open machine-learning-cheat-sheet.tex with TeXstudio，click the green arrow on the menu bar, then it will start to compile.
In the messages window below we can see the compilation command that TeXstudio is using is xelatex -synctex=1 --enable-write18 -interaction=nonstopmode "machine-learning-cheat-sheet".tex